Top 5 Restaurants to Try in Roanoke, VA

Roanoke’s food scene has something for everyone. From fine dining to barbecue and late-night classics, here are five of the best places to eat when you are in town.

1. Alexander’s

A fine dining gem in downtown Roanoke with a charming ambiance and a sophisticated menu. Expect Virginia-aged prime meats, fresh seafood, and locally sourced ingredients. With its vintage setting and stellar service, it is perfect for date nights or special occasions.

2. Lucky Restaurant

Lucky is a long-time favorite that serves elevated comfort food with creative twists. Known for seasonal small plates, craft cocktails, and a warm atmosphere, it is a reliable choice for an impressive dinner.

3. The River and Rail

This farm-to-table Southern bistro highlights organic and seasonal dishes in an intimate setting. The menu blends comfort with innovation, making it one of Roanoke’s most respected destinations for fresh, locally inspired cuisine.

4. Mama Jean’s BBQ

What started as a food trailer has grown into one of the most talked about barbecue spots in the area. Mama Jean’s is known for Texas-style brisket, smoked wings, and sides like cheese grits and potato salad that keep people coming back.

5. Texas Tavern

A true Roanoke institution since 1930, Texas Tavern is tiny but unforgettable. The famous “Cheesy Western” burger topped with egg, pickles, and relish is a must-try, and the no-frills atmosphere makes it a piece of local history.
